It's a shame that the COPO's are not street legal. They don't even have a VIN so they cannot be licensed.

In the right state (montana) for example, make a few changes and it can be classified a custom or kit status and the state issues a Vin number and title. Then you could theoretical move to another state and bam, 8 second daily driver
